There are several ingredients typically included in bread improvers. Each plays a vital role in improving the dough's performance and the bread's final texture and flavor.
Enzymes are crucial in bread improvers. They break down starches and proteins into simpler sugars and amino acids, which enhance fermentation and improve dough elasticity. Common enzymes used include:
